I got it working, using this guide: wejn.org/…/fixing-grub-verification-requested-nob….

Certainly an unorthodox grub hack, but it’s replicatable and it works. Maybe in the future systemd boot or the refind will gain the features I want. Until then, only grub offers what I want.

If a grub update ever breaks this, or maybe just to futureproof this, then I’ll probably just use Arch’s PKGBUILD, makepkg, and patch tools to patch the grub_efi_get_secureboot function of sb.c so that grub always thinks it’s not in secure boot. And maybe put that version on the AUR.
